Output 8f3889bc3e9634fa21084db32223816cd00f176fca566461b86a54e42e389f39:1

value
370649
script pubkey
OP_0 OP_PUSHBYTES_20 945804ad4528ecd81358b3b1ef372d5549f6c6d0
address
bc1qj3vqft299rkdsy6ckwc77ded24yld3kskwjqu6
transaction
8f3889bc3e9634fa21084db32223816cd00f176fca566461b86a54e42e389f39
spent
true